Poured Steps Installation in Sacramento, CA
Poured steps installation services involve creating durable, smooth concrete staircases that enhance both functionality and curb appeal. This service is commonly used for outdoor projects such as front entryways, garden paths, patios, and poolside access, providing a seamless and sturdy solution for property transitions. Homeowners typically request this service when replacing existing steps, adding new access points, or upgrading aging or damaged stairs to improve safety and aesthetics.
Before requesting poured steps installation, property owners should consider the desired style, height, and number of steps needed for their project. It’s also helpful to understand the surrounding landscape and any grading or drainage requirements to ensure proper installation. Clarifying preferences for finishes, textures, and any integrated features like handrails or lighting can help achieve a result that complements the property's overall design.

Poured Steps Installation Questions
What are poured steps? Poured steps are concrete stairs that are cast in place to create durable and seamless outdoor or indoor stairways.
What types of projects are suitable for poured steps? They are ideal for residential entrances, patios, garden paths, and other outdoor areas requiring sturdy, long-lasting stairs.
How long does the installation process typically take? Installation duration varies based on project size, but generally includes site preparation, form setting, pouring, and curing.
What should property owners consider before installation? It's important to plan for proper drainage, surface finish preferences, and existing landscape integration.
